What was the greatest cause of World War I

Respuesta :

Rosiecheeks2007
Rosiecheeks2007 Rosiecheeks2007
  • 25-03-2021
The immediate cause of World War I that made the aforementioned items come into play (alliances, imperialism, militarism, nationalism) was the ass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and of Austria-Hungary. ... Thus began the expansion of the war to include all those involved in the mutual defense alliances
